Tragedy struck the pro wrestling world in may 2003 when the first lady of wrestling elizabeth ann hulette, better known as miss elizabeth, passed away in an overdose accident The wrestling manager and wife of randy savage died at 42 in 2003
Her autopsy revealed she had been drinking and taking pills before cardiac arrest, and had bruises and cuts from a fight with her boyfriend lex luger. After high school, she enrolled at the university of kentucky, from which she obtained a degree in communications. Miss elizabeth, real name elizabeth ann hulette, was a wwe manager and wcw star who died of an overdose in 2003
She was in a relationship with lex luger, another wrestler who struggled with addiction and abuse, and was charged with battery after her death.
